Navigating Uncertainty: The Power of Fixing and Flexing in PRINCE2 Agile
In the dynamic landscape of project management, uncertainty is an inherent constant. PRINCE2 Agile provides a framework to successfully navigate this volatility by embracing the principles of fixing and flexing. Fixing refers to establishing clear parameters for specific aspects of the project, ensuring reliability. Flexing, on the other hand, allows for adaptation based on changing circumstances, promoting responsiveness. By striking a balance between these two approaches, PRINCE2 Agile empowers teams to overcome uncertainty and deliver successful projects in a complex world.
